Capture Quiz Results to a Excel spreadsheet - The thread mentioned 2 ways to do it:

  1. Using Google Doc Forms and embedding it to Storyline as a web object. (Possibly the easiest way)
  2. Convert a javascript text file into a CSV file. See example here.

Export the scores from Articulate Storyline to Excel - This thread suggests you to make some modification in the .html file and requires a database set up.

Storing QuizMaker results in a database - If you a have an existing database set up, you may download the open source code for a web interface enables you to download results per quiz, per student or per class in CSV format.
